    Trust of the police force in key institutions represents a key precondition for coherent functioning of the state and effective law enforcement. This article presents the results of the research mapping the level of institutional trust among Czech members of the police force focusing on their attitudes towards political, judicial, and economic actors. The data, collected through a questionnaire survey among the members of the police force, are interpreted in context and compared with data from international public opinion surveys – the Eurobarometer and the Edelman Trust Barometer. The analysis identifies substantial variations in trust across institutions and media. A consistent pattern emerged, showing that older and longer-serving officers tend to express lower trust in the political regime and the media, yet report higher satisfaction with their income. Gender differences were also observed: female officers are generally less trusting towards business leaders and journalists and display slightly greater support for protest activities. The article offers valuable insights for the theory of social trust and for decision makers in the sphere of public administration and security.
